For its analysis, The Post relied on dozens of tide gauges along the coasts of the United States, measurements that are affected both by the rising ocean and slow but persistent movement of land. It also took into account satellite data for global sea level rise, which measures ocean heights independent of land movement. A linear regression model was applied to the annual means for each gauge to determine the trends for each time period and calculate an annual rate of relative mean sea level rise.

Their 3/4 mile Raptor Trail is an educational visitor attraction that displays over 25 different species of raptors in a nature preserve setting in Huntersville, NC. The Jim Arthur Raptor Medical Center on the property sees over 900 injured and orphaned raptors a year — releasing almost 70% of the birds that live for the first 24 hours back into the wild.

NASCAR Hall of Fame 3 Hour Tour Located in Uptown Charlotte next to the convention center, the 150,000-square-foot NASCAR Hall of Fame is an interactive, entertainment attraction honoring the history and heritage of NASCAR. The high-tech venue, designed to educate and entertain race fans and non-fans alike, opened May 11, 2010 and includes artifacts, interactive exhibits, and a 278-person state-of-the-art theater. Also on the property is Buffalo Wild Wings restaurant and the NASCAR Hall of Fame Gear Shop. The goal of the facility is to honor NASCAR icons and create an enduring tribute to the drivers, crew members, team owners and others that have impacted the sport in the past, present and future.

Most colonial style houses feature at least two stories,  though there are exceptions- the Spanish Colonial House. Typically, colonial houses are two stories; in some cases, they are limited to one. A single-story house is commonly found in the South, whereas in the North, you will find a two- or three-story design. These Colonial homes are mostly rectangular with sloping roofs decorated by gables, often constructed with bricks, wood, or stone exteriors. Bedrooms commonly cover the upper floor, while living spaces and kitchens are located on the ground floor. A standout feature is the arrangement of a large fireplace, usually designed at the home's centre or rear.

Colonial revival house plans are typically two to three story home designs with symmetrical facades and gable roofs. Pillars and columns are common, often expressed in temple-like entrances with porticos topped by pediments. Multi-pane, double-hung windows with shutters, dormers, and paneled doors with sidelights topped with rectangular transoms or fanlights help dress up the exteriors which are generally wood or brick. Additional common features include center entry-hall floor plan, fireplaces, and simple, classical detailing. Inspired by the practical homes built by early Dutch, English, French, and Spanish settlers in the American colonies, colonial house plans often feature a salt box shape and are built in wood or brick. Colonial style homes may also sport classical details, such as columned or pedimented porticoes and multi-pane double-hung windows with shutters.
